Reclaimed Wood Accents for Instant Rustic Charm
Incorporate reclaimed wood into your bathroom for character and warmth. Build a vanity from salvaged barn wood or create a floating shelf using old fence planks. Apply a clear matte finish to highlight the natural grain and knots. For a dramatic touch, install a shiplap wall using mismatched planks—no need for perfect alignment, as imperfections add authenticity. Pair with vintage-style hardware for a cohesive look.
Natural Material Mix: Stone, Clay, and Textiles
Embrace earthy textures by combining materials like river rocks for a shower floor, handmade clay tiles, or a concrete sink. Create a textured accent wall using handmade clay plaster—mix sand and clay for a rustic finish. Drape a jute rug over cool tile floors to soften the space. For towels, choose linen or cotton in muted greens, browns, or terracotta to enhance the organic feel.
Simple DIY Fixtures: Sinks, Lighting, and Storage
Make your own vessel sink using a repurposed ceramic bowl or a cut-down wooden stump. Install a rustic pendant light with a raw metal frame and exposed filament bulb. For storage, build a wall-mounted cabinet from recycled pallet wood or use mason jars as toothbrush holders. A DIY towel rack made from a single branch adds whimsy while keeping the space clutter-free.
